20A-9-602. Write-in candidacy and voting prohibited in certain circumstances.
In elections for county attorney or district attorney that meet the requirements ofSubsections 20A-6-302(3) and (4), a person may not file a declaration of candidacy as a write-incandidate under this part and the county clerk may not count any write-in votes received for theoffice of county or district attorney.

Enacted by Chapter 139, 1997 General Session
